The testimony of the top NASA scientist, said Rice University historian Douglas Brinkley, was \u201cthe opening salvo of the age of climate change.\u201d Before that, most scientists knew that increased greenhouse gases in the atmosphere were likely to raise the earth&#8217;s temperature but it was not common knowledge in most American households. This event galvanized supporters and skeptics of global warming, provoking a debate that is now more heated than ever (pun intended).\u00a0 Seth Borenstein of <em>AP<\/em> has posted two stories this week on the global warming debate that you may find informative.
